Transaction 524ae201bd3088e53db68e084f57d88f10c2556482c257ce88923a9bb8badfbb
1 Input
2 Outputs
- 524ae201bd3088e53db68e084f57d88f10c2556482c257ce88923a9bb8badfbb:0
- 524ae201bd3088e53db68e084f57d88f10c2556482c257ce88923a9bb8badfbb:1
value 6084293
address 3LedeeHHfAK4rKL8x9hhLe4Wh3Zi7T6uLb
value 15697067
address 1Gew6idBFiCfgWaiT9uqNFKsbtzXCXTDFk